The show blends paranormal folklore, religious interpretation, and skeptical inquiry with humor and banter. Episodes frequently explore haunted histories, cryptid lore, and supernatural phenomena through a Christian lens, often weighing spiritual explanations against scientific or skeptical viewpoints while weaving in personal anecdotes, historical context, and cultural analysis. A standout is the consistent use of vivid storytelling, cross-cutting narratives, and the hosts' willingness to broach controversial topics with warmth and humor, which helps make esoteric subjects approachable for a broad audience.
